Author
Peter the apostle
Written
Around AD 62-64
Genre
Letter (epistle)
Original Audience
Persecuted Christians in Asia Minor

In this you greatly rejoice, even though now for a little while, if necessary, you are distressed by various trials:

KJVKing James Version

Wherein ye greatly rejoice, though now for a season, if need be, ye are in heaviness through manifold temptations:

What does 1 Peter 1:6 mean?

1 Peter 1:6 emphasizes finding joy even in difficult times. It acknowledges that while you may face various trials, these challenges are temporary and can lead to personal growth.

What is the meaning of 'manifold temptations' in 1 Peter 1:6?

'Manifold temptations' refers to various types of challenges or struggles that one may encounter. These trials can be overwhelming, but they are also opportunities for growth and resilience.

The Book of 1 Peter

1–2: Living as God's people

Peter, an apostle of Jesus Christ, writes to the believers scattered throughout various regions, identifying them as elect according to God's foreknowledge. He blesses God for giving them a living hope through the resurrection of Jesus Christ, an incorruptible inheritance reserved in heaven. Though they face various trials, their faith is being tested and proven genuine, which will result in praise, honor, and glory at the revelation of Jesus Christ. Peter calls them to be holy in all their conduct, just as God who called them is holy, reminding them that they were redeemed not with silver or gold but with the precious blood of Christ. Having been born again through the living and abiding word of God, they are to love one another earnestly from a pure heart.
